What is the APHA Show Lease Authorization?
The APHA Show Lease Authorization is a crucial document for establishing ownership eligibility for leased horses in APHA-approved shows. This form plays an essential role for participants in horse shows, ensuring that both owners and lessees are compliant with the regulations set forth by the APHA. It is necessary to file the APHA lease authorization with the organization before the horse can be exhibited.

What are the eligibility requirements for using the APHA Show Lease Authorization form?
To use the APHA Show Lease Authorization form, you must be a registered horse owner or a lessee of an APHA-approved horse. Ensure your horse is eligible for APHA shows and that all required information is accurately provided.
Is there a deadline for submitting the lease authorization?
The lease authorization form must be submitted to the APHA before the horse can be exhibited. It should be filed prior to the start of the show season, and the lease expires on December 31 of the year in which it is submitted.
What methods are available for submitting the APHA Show Lease Authorization form?
You can submit the completed APHA Show Lease Authorization form electronically via pdfFiller or print and mail it to the APHA. Ensure you follow the submission guidelines printed on the form.
What supporting documents are required for the lease authorization?
Typically, you will need to provide the registered horse's name, registration number, and signatures from both the owner and the lessee. Ensure all information is accurate to avoid processing issues.
What common mistakes should I avoid when completing the lease form?
Common mistakes include entering incorrect horse registration details, failing to sign the document, or missing required fields. Carefully review the form for completeness before submission to prevent delays.
How long does it take to process the APHA Show Lease Authorization?
Processing times for the lease authorization may vary, but it is advisable to submit it as early as possible. Standard processing could take several days, while rush processing is available for an additional fee.
Can I make changes to the form after submitting it?
Once the APHA Show Lease Authorization form is submitted, any required changes usually need to be addressed directly with APHA. Contact their office for instructions on making alterations.
